What are your top three guns you wish you never sold or traded and why? I'll start. 1 my Mosin Nagant, got it as my first gun show purchase with my first Christmas bonus from my first year at my first real job. Only paid $130. Sold it a year later and now jerks want $500 for them. 2 My Colt Official Police .38 special made in 1942. Got it from a friend's dad. Was my first handgun that started my love of revolvers, sold it to pay off a traffic ticket. 3 My Savage 726. This is a bird hunting gun based on the Browning A5. If you type that in on GunBroker there are none for sale. It was flawlessly reliable and I foolishly traded it for a Sears and Roebuck pump because I didn't like the Savage's two shot tube and wanted more capacity. that Sears jam o matic "got hung up" as us mountain folk say (failure to feed) all the time.
